We’ve loved up this movie before, but having just come out of a screening at the Bioneers conference in Marin, it was too great not to remind all about its pertinence to the current state of affairs, and not just for the agricultural world—to all of us.
As Michael Pollan said in the movie, “bees are the legs of plants”, and if they are threatened or destroyed by a phenomenon coined Colony Collapse Disorder, it means our ability to grow nearly half of our food becomes paralyzed.
